Hi Carol... shag is a lot like swing, but it's a more individually styled dance. The 6-count, basic pattern dance with modified footwork centers all the action below the waist... The thing to remember with shag dancing, though, is how seriously it's taken.
Phil Sawyer, President Emeritus of S.O.S. (Society of Stranders, a Myrtle Beach shagging society) told us that "Serious shaggers are in a lifestyle, which goes way beyond the dance, it's a camaraderie thing," and that seems like the best way to describe it.
